Just before lunch was over, Lelia had been the last one left at the table. The girl was planning on meeting with Bridget, but remembered that she didn't have the same class as her next, so there was no point.

The girl was on her phone, as she waited impatiently for lunch to finish. People in her year, walked past and gave her bright smiles, which she returned to the best of her ability, before continuing to go on her phone.

When the blonde got bored, she stood up and grabbed her bag off the bench next to her. The air fairy put her phone into her jacket pocket, after she had secured her bag on her shoulders.

The girl walked through the cafeteria, waving at people, as she passed, until she stopped short in her tracks, when she saw the boy that she had been thinking about all of lunch time.

Sam Harvey walked passed her, not noticing her, as he waved at a few people in their year, who were sat down at a table. Lelia pursed her lips, debating whether or not she should try and catch up to him, which she eventually decided to do.

The air fairy apologised, as she bumped into a few people, while trying to catch up to the boy, who was faster than her due to his long legs.

When Lelia made it to the end of the room, he was nowhere to be seen. Lelia's eyes held confusion, as she looked both ways he could have gone, but found no sight of him.

He couldn't have disappeared. Lelia swore she was going insane and just decided to slowly walk backwards and peeked out of her blonde locks, to make sure no one was looking at her strangely, for travelling to the end of the room for no reason.

Lelia rocked on her heels, before turning around, which caused her to stumble slightly, from turning around too fast. Luckily, no one was nearby to witness it, because she was at the end of the room and people were already walking out of the cafeteria to get ready for their next class.
